Every comprehensive course involves certain theories and follows certain rules en route to its successful completion. A network of complex rules and regulations, the educational courses like the TEFL in-class courses deal with a number of loopholes, which might deter the growth and development of the learners to a great extent. The usage of algorithms might help in eradicating these loopholes and develop a co-ordinated impact on the teaching-learning procedure. This is essential for the enhancement of the students and also the development of co-ordination between the students and the teachers.
What is an Algorithm?
An algorithm can be defined as a procedure which is directed towards solving a particular problem. Though it is generally used to get rid of the common problems related to computer programming, the same can also be utilised to derive the best possible way to help both the educator and the learners find a feasible way towards successful completion of a comprehensive course.
In the case of the TEFL in-class courses, the students need to go through a number of variations in the course curriculum, which might put them in a fix. The usage of algorithms tends to ease the procedure and help the learners towards the successful completion of the course curriculum in a pre-defined way.
In the following lines, we will have a look at the features of an algorithm and how they help in developing the mentality of the learners indulging in a comprehensive course like the TEFL In-Class Courses.
- Develops Precision
Every educational course is a conjugation of a number of processes and methodologies and tends to take more than one way towards the completion of the course. The usage of algorithms can help in making the whole process much more precise and centred towards the development of the mentality of the learners. This not only helps the learners, but also provides the teacher with newer ways to deliver the course content in a feasible way.
In the case of the professional courses, things tend to get a little monotonous at times, which might make the learners unattached with the course content and the educator. The usage of algorithms helps in finding newer ways for the delivery of the curriculum so that things don’t get boring for the participants and an air of co-ordination is present in the teaching-learning procedure.
- Determination of a Finite Target
A pre-determined target is what the course curriculum is directed towards. However, one of the prime features of an algorithm is the development of a finite target, which is feasible to achieve for both the educator and the learners. This helps in understanding the right way to go about the completion of a course while not disturbing the flow of study during the TEFL In-Class Courses.
- Input channels
The determination of the correct channels for the input of the course content in a logical and pre-determined way is another important utilisation of the algorithms. Algorithms help in establishing the correct path for the delivery of the course curriculum to the learners and thus strengthen their future by enhancing the learning experience.
- Generalising the theories
Theories of education are not always easy to understand, especially for the learners who have enrolled in a comprehensive course such as the TEFL in-class courses. The inclusion of algorithms in the educational process helps to generalise the curriculum and reduces the problem of understanding even the hardest of topics present in a course curriculum. This helps in contemplating the problems and develops a co-ordinated effort in the teaching-learning procedure.
However, there are certain disadvantages that might be detrimental for the learners while indulging in a comprehensive course.
- Algorithms are time consuming and not every educator might be ready to utilise them in their curriculum.
- The educator might not be able to understand student psychology and segregate the students according to their needs.
- Application of algorithms might not be viable to be implemented in courses spanning to a considerable amount of time, like, a year.
Apart from the aforementioned cases, the usage of algorithms in developing a concrete educational course can be huge. It can help to break down the bulk of complex knowledge and develops certain newer ways to deliver the knowledge to the learners in a properly synchronised teaching-learning procedure, especially in case of in-class courses like the TEFL.